Ephialtes is one of the characters in the film 300.
He is played by Andrew Tiernan.

Ephialtes is a deformed hunchback in exile whose parents ran away from Sparta. Hoping to redeem his
dad, he volunteers to Leonidas to join the army. But, Ephialtes is too weak to raise up his shield high enough
so Leonidas rejects him. Mad at this, he goes to Xerxes and betrays his own country to get a reward. Ephialtes
tells the Persians a pass that only locals know. In real life, Ephialtes never got the reward and was killed.
